Moderation Team Software Engineer
2 months ago
**About Reddit**
Reddit is a community-driven platform that fosters open and authentic conversations on the internet. With millions of active communities and daily visitors, Reddit is a leading source of information and a hub for shared interests.
**The Moderation Organization**
The Moderation organization plays a crucial role in Reddit's success by building features that enable moderators to create and grow meaningful communities. Moderators are community leaders and tastemakers, ensuring that Reddit has something for everyone.
**Job Summary**
We are seeking a highly skilled Senior Software Engineer to join our Moderation team. As a key member of this team, you will drive new features from end-to-end, craft a modern user experience, and contribute to a Reddit design system.
**Responsibilities**
- Drive new features from end-to-end through prototyping, validation, implementation, launch, and continuous iteration.
- Help craft a modern user experience for accessing content and communities on Reddit.
- Contribute to a Reddit design system, a component library paired with UI best practices and tools for our design team to enable teams at Reddit to work faster and at a higher quality bar.
- Help build the technical foundation for future features and experiences.
- Focus on frontend development.
**Requirements**
- + years of experience in web application development using JavaScript, TypeScript, or other relevant language.
- Experience with one or more front-end web frameworks such as React, Vue, or Angular.
- Experience with Web Components or LitElement is a huge plus, but not required.
- Experience in one or more general-purpose programming languages (e.g. JavaScript, Typescript, Python, Java, Go, Scala).
- Deep experience with a modern web stack, whether it's Javascript bundlers, React internals, etc. You've debugged it, you've improved it, you can imagine doing it better.
- Familiar with software engineering best practices such as unit testing, code reviews, design, and documentation.
- Passion for developing scalable, well-designed software that improves people's lives globally.
- Strong organizational skills, the ability to prioritize tasks and keep projects on schedule.
- Entrepreneurial spirit. You are self-directed, innovative, and biased towards action in fast-paced environments. You love to build new things and thrive in ambiguity and even failure.
- Excellent communication skills. You collaborate effectively with teams in a fully remote environment and discuss complex topics with technical and non-technical audiences.
- BS degree in Computer Science, a similar technical field of study or equivalent practical experience.
**What We Offer**
- Comprehensive Healthcare Benefits
- k Matching
- Workspace benefits for your home office
- Personal & Professional development funds
- Family Planning Support
- Flexible Vacation (please use them) & Reddit Global Wellness Days
- + months paid Parental Leave
- Paid Volunteer time off
-
Senior Software Engineer
1 month ago
Vancouver, British Columbia, Canada reddit Full timeAbout RedditReddit is a community-driven platform where users share and discuss content on a wide range of topics. As a key member of our Moderation team, you will play a crucial role in building features that enable moderators to create and grow meaningful communities.Job SummaryWe are seeking a highly skilled Full Stack Engineer to join our Moderation...
-
Senior Software Engineer
1 month ago
Vancouver, British Columbia, Canada reddit Full timeAbout RedditReddit is a community-driven platform where users share and discuss content on a wide range of topics. As a key member of our Moderation team, you will play a crucial role in building features that enable moderators to create and grow meaningful communities.Job SummaryWe are seeking a highly skilled Full Stack Engineer to join our Moderation...
-
Senior Software Engineer
2 months ago
Vancouver, British Columbia, Canada reddit Full time{"Job SummaryWe're seeking a highly skilled Full Stack Engineer to join our Moderation team at Reddit. As a key member of our team, you will be responsible for building features that enable moderators to create and grow meaningful, destination communities.Key Responsibilities* Drive new features from end-to-end through prototyping, validation,...
-
Senior Software Engineer
2 months ago
Vancouver, British Columbia, Canada reddit Full time{"Job SummaryWe're seeking a highly skilled Full Stack Engineer to join our Moderation team at Reddit. As a key member of our team, you will be responsible for building features that enable moderators to create and grow meaningful, destination communities.Key Responsibilities* Drive new features from end-to-end through prototyping, validation,...
-
Senior Software Engineer
4 weeks ago
Vancouver, British Columbia, Canada reddit Full timeAbout RedditReddit is a community-driven platform where users share and discuss content on a wide range of topics. As a key member of our Moderation team, you will play a crucial role in building features that enable moderators to create and grow meaningful communities.Job SummaryWe are seeking a highly skilled Full Stack Engineer to join our Moderation...
-
Senior Software Engineer
4 weeks ago
Vancouver, British Columbia, Canada reddit Full timeAbout RedditReddit is a community-driven platform where users share and discuss content on a wide range of topics. As a key member of our Moderation team, you will play a crucial role in building features that enable moderators to create and grow meaningful communities.Job SummaryWe are seeking a highly skilled Full Stack Engineer to join our Moderation...
-
Vancouver, British Columbia, Canada reddit Full timeJob Description:At Reddit, we're passionate about building a platform that enables community leaders and moderators to create and grow meaningful, destination communities. We're seeking an experienced Senior Software Engineer to join our Moderation team, where you will be responsible for driving the development of our moderation platform.Key...
-
Senior Software Engineer
3 weeks ago
Vancouver, British Columbia, Canada reddit Full timeAbout RedditReddit is a community-driven platform that fosters open and authentic conversations on the internet. With millions of active users and a vast array of communities, Reddit is a hub for sharing ideas, passions, and interests.Job DescriptionWe're seeking a highly skilled Full Stack Engineer to join our Moderation team. As a key member of our team,...
-
Full Stack Software Engineer
2 months ago
Vancouver, British Columbia, Canada reddit Full time**About Reddit**Reddit is a community-driven platform that fosters open and authentic conversations on the internet. With millions of active communities and daily visitors, Reddit is a leading source of information and a hub for shared interests.**The Moderation Organization**The Moderation organization plays a crucial role in Reddit's success by building...
-
Full Stack Software Engineer
2 months ago
Vancouver, British Columbia, Canada reddit Full time**About Reddit**Reddit is a community-driven platform that fosters open and authentic conversations on the internet. With millions of active communities and daily visitors, Reddit is a leading source of information and a hub for shared interests.**The Moderation Organization**The Moderation organization plays a crucial role in Reddit's success by building...
-
Software Engineer II With React Experience
1 month ago
Vancouver, British Columbia, Canada Triunity Software Full timeJob Title: Software Engineer II With React ExperienceWe are seeking a highly skilled Software Engineer II with expertise in React to join our team at Triunity Software Inc.About the Role:This is a challenging and rewarding opportunity for a talented software engineer to contribute to the development of cutting-edge web applications using React, GraphQL, and...
-
Senior Software Engineer for a Dynamic Team
7 days ago
Vancouver, British Columbia, Canada Saba Software (Canada) Inc. Full timeAbout the Role:As a senior software engineer, you will be responsible for designing, developing, and maintaining complex software systems. With a focus on innovation, you will work closely with our team to deliver high-quality solutions that meet the needs of our clients.Key Responsibilities:• Collaborate with cross-functional teams to identify and...
-
Software Quality Assurance Engineer
1 week ago
Vancouver, British Columbia, Canada Software Aspekte Full timeJob SummaryWe are seeking a skilled Software Quality Assurance Engineer to join our team at Software Aspekte. The ideal candidate will have a passion for functional testing and automation of embedded devices.About the RoleThe Software Quality Assurance Engineer will be responsible for designing, implementing, and exercising comprehensive testing strategies...
-
Full Stack Software Engineer II
3 weeks ago
Vancouver, British Columbia, Canada Procurify Full timeAbout the RoleProcurify is seeking a highly skilled Full Stack Software Engineer II to join our team of talented engineers. As a key member of our software development team, you will be responsible for designing, developing, and maintaining our SaaS application.Key ResponsibilitiesDesign and implement new features in our existing application based on...
-
Senior Backend Software Engineer
1 month ago
Vancouver, British Columbia, Canada Aequilibrium Software Inc Full time $90,000 - $120,000{"title": "Senior Backend Software Engineer", "description": "Senior Backend Software EngineerW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Aequilibrium Software Inc.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our company's backend systems.Key...
-
Senior Backend Software Engineer
1 month ago
Vancouver, British Columbia, Canada Aequilibrium Software Inc Full time $90,000 - $120,000{"title": "Senior Backend Software Engineer", "description": "Senior Backend Software EngineerW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Aequilibrium Software Inc.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our company's backend systems.Key...
-
Software Quality Assurance Engineer
1 month ago
Vancouver, British Columbia, Canada Software Aspekte Full timeAbout the PositionWe are seeking a skilled SQA and test engineer to join our team at Software Aspekte. The ideal candidate will have a passion for functional testing and automation of embedded devices.Key Responsibilities:Design, implement, and exercise comprehensive testing strategies for our IP based phone portfolio.Monitor testing progress, analyze...
-
Software Quality Assurance Engineer
1 month ago
Vancouver, British Columbia, Canada Software Aspekte Full timeAbout the PositionWe are seeking a skilled SQA and test engineer to join our team at Software Aspekte. The ideal candidate will have a passion for functional testing and automation of embedded devices.Key Responsibilities:Design, implement, and exercise comprehensive testing strategies for our IP based phone portfolio.Monitor testing progress, analyze...
-
Senior Backend Software Engineer
2 months ago
Vancouver, British Columbia, Canada Aequilibrium Software Inc Full time $90,000 - $120,000{"title": "Senior Backend Software Engineer", "description": "Senior Backend Software EngineerW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Aequilibrium Software Inc.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our company\u2019s backend systems.Key...
-
Senior Backend Software Engineer
2 months ago
Vancouver, British Columbia, Canada Aequilibrium Software Inc Full time $90,000 - $120,000{"title": "Senior Backend Software Engineer", "description": "Senior Backend Software EngineerWe are seeking a highly skilled Senior Backend Software Engineer to join our team at Aequilibrium Software Inc.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our company\u2019s backend systems.Key...